Developments In Melting For Tft Glass

JSJ Jodeit, supplier of glass furnaces, has been working on the melting of completely sodium-free alumo-borosilicate glasses used for H4 car lamps, TFT screens and other electronic purposes. Generally these melts are characterised by extreme properties such as a strong dependence on temperature of viscosity, high corrosivity to normal fused cast refractory materials and very low electrical conductivity. However, the quality demands - especially regarding bubbles, dissolved gases and several components - are very high, despite limitations in using refining agents. The company has been following two directions in this field which are described in this paper.
